I am currently a postdoctoral researcher at IPMU, University of Tokyo. Prior to that, I spent two years as research fellow at KIAS.

I got my PhD from the IMS and Department of Mathematics at Chinese University of Hong Kong in July 2009, under the guidance of Professor Naichung Conan Leung. I spent my undergraduate years at University of Science and Technology of China .

Research Insterests

I am interested in Algebraic Geometry, Kahler Geometry, with special emphasis on Gromov-Witten theory and Quantum Schubert Calculas. Currently, I am also interested in quantum K-theory of flag varieties.
